They took Piggy´s glasses, but didn´t take the conch. The conch is only a symbol of authority and has power only when the society agrees that it

does. For Jack, the shell is, now, only a shell. The glasses, however, give him real power because he is the only one with the ability to start a fire. "He was a chief now, in truth." (Pg. 168)
